Manatee County's Community Garden Program is dedicated to the development and education of new and existing community gardens. Through research based methods, professional advice and educational outreach, the Community Gardens Program is devoted to creating successful, functional and socially uplifting garden spaces. We offer assistance with all types of community gardens including vegetable, fruit and pollinator gardens.
